In preperation for my trip to the Keys I downloaded Margaritaville by Jimmy Buffet. When I try and play it on the iPod only the first 27 seconds will play then, iPod starts the next song. If I "scroll" past 27 seconds the rest of the song will play.

I have delted the song from iPod (via the sync only check song options) and upgraded the iPod software, and the iTunes software. Last night I used the restore factor defaults option in the iPod updater and then reloaded all the music. Still the same thing.

Anyone ever have a simmular problem? I have apple care for the iPod and my G5. Should I take this to the Apple store? Could the song from iTMS be "bad", anf if so can I get a new download somehow?
